The Motad system Annitore sells cmes with our Street Magic 90 degree elbow and sounds very close to a Micron. It also has a removable baffle that helps cut down the sound a bit in case you want a more subdued sound.

It is one of the 4 types of systems we sell for the Spyder, and a good choice indeed. :2thumbs:

The $399 price you got if from ebay for it is a bit high, but overall not too bad for this system. :thumbup:
